Inclusion Criteria

Subjects with BCVA 20/20 in each eye.

Subjects with refractive errors between Sph+/-10D, Cyl +/-5D.

Exclusion Criteria

Subjects with significant media opacity- corneal opacity, advanced cataract, vitreous hemorrhage. posterior segment pathology affecting visual acuity, amblyopia and inability to fixate, active eye infection, inflammation.

Primary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Demonstrate the performance of InstaRef R20 when compared against subjective refraction (gold standard). <br/ ><br>Timepoint: At the end of the study <br/ ><br>
Secondary Outcome Measures
NameTimeMethod
Demonstrate the substantial equivalence in terms of performance and safety of a InstaRef R20 in measuring refractive errors when compared against a Open field AR, Plusoptic, Quicksee and standard tabletop autorefractor Topcon ARK 800. <br/ ><br>Timepoint: At the end of the trail
